🚘 What Is the BYD Seal?

The BYD Seal is an all‑electric sedan featuring innovative battery technology, sporty performance, and modern design. Officially launched in 2022, the Seal is part of BYD’s premium “Ocean Series” EV family and showcases the company’s commitment to sustainable mobility.

Unlike traditional EVs that rely on Nickel‑based batteries, the BYD Seal often uses Blade Battery technology — a superior lithium iron phosphate (LFP) battery system known for enhanced safety, longevity, and thermal stability. According to BYD, Blade Batteries are less prone to combustion under stress, contributing to a stronger safety profile.

⚙️ Performance and Specifications

The BYD Seal is offered in multiple powertrain configurations, ranging from rear‑wheel drive to dual‑motor all‑wheel drive setups. Highlights include:

  • Impressive acceleration: 0–100 km/h (0–62 mph) in as quick as ~3.8 seconds in performance variants

  • Top speed: Up to approximately 190 km/h (118 mph)

  • Driving range: Estimated up to ~700 km (~435 miles) WLTP in long‑range versions

  • Battery: Blade Battery LFP for safety and longevity

These figures place the BYD Seal competitively among premium EV sedans and offer a performance edge for drivers who want both speed and efficiency without compromise.

Note: Exact range and performance vary depending on model trim, driving conditions, and testing standards.

🔋 Battery and Charging

One of the Seal’s most talked‑about features is the Blade Battery, developed by BYD to prioritize safety and longevity. Several independent reports suggest Blade Batteries can withstand significant mechanical stress without thermal runaway — a key concern in EV safety.

Charging options include:

  • DC fast charging capability

  • AC home charging

  • Regenerative braking to recover energy during deceleration

Typical charging speeds vary, but many users can expect 30‑80% charge within 30–40 minutes using a compatible fast charger.

🌍 Sustainability and Environmental Impact

As a fully electric vehicle, the BYD Seal helps reduce greenhouse gas emissions — particularly when charged from renewable energy sources. BYD also promotes sustainable battery materials and recycling efforts, which are increasingly important in EV lifecycle management.
